Abstract
The invention regards a system and method for using a handheld programming device to configure a lighting control system wirelessly. In one embodiment, at least one device configured with a processing section is installed in the lighting control system. A communications receiver that is operable to receive a signal from the handheld programming device is also installed in the lighting control system, wherein the signal includes an instruction for configuring the lighting control system. Further, the signal is wirelessly sent from the handheld programming device to the communications receiver, and the instruction is transmitted from the communications receiver to a device in the system. The instruction functions to configure the lighting control system.

3. A system for replacement of a plurality of ballasts in a lighting control system, the system comprising:
-
a bus supply that is electronically connected to the lighting control system by a communication bus and that stores configuration information regarding respective configuration settings for each of a first plurality of ballasts;
the first plurality of ballasts replaced with a second plurality of ballasts; and
a handheld programming device operable to transmit wirelessly an instruction to the bus supply to configure each of the second plurality of ballasts with the respective configurations of each of the first plurality of ballasts, wherein the bus supply is operable to use the configuration information to configure each of the second plurality of ballasts with the respective configurations of each of the first plurality of ballasts.

4. A system for maintaining information representing devices installed in a lighting control system, the system comprising:
-
a plurality of ballasts, wherein each of the plurality of ballasts has configuration information stored therein, wherein the respective configuration information represents a respective configuration setting of the respective ballast;
a bus supply that stores the respective configuration information for all of the ballasts; and
a communication bus interconnecting the plurality of ballasts and the bus supply. - View Dependent Claims (5, 6, 7)
